A suspect, who entered a bank branch wearing a mask and wielding a machete to attempt a robbery, was caught and arrested by police teams following a swift intervention.
A masked individual in Mersin entered a bank branch with a cleaver and attempted to commit robbery.
RAN AWAY WHEN NOTICED
According to a statement from the Mersin Provincial Police Department, while the Narcotics and Crime Prevention teams affiliated with the Toroslar District Police Department were continuing their efforts to prevent crime, they received information about a robbery attempt at a bank branch in the district. It was reported that the suspect, who was masked and armed with a cutting tool, fled on foot after being noticed by the bank security.
ESCAPE ROUTES WERE BLOCKED
Upon receiving the tip-off, teams that quickly arrived at the scene blocked the escape routes and initiated a large-scale operation in the area. As a result of meticulous surveillance, a suspect named B.D. was caught along with the weapon used in the crime, a cleaver, a mask, and gloves.
SENT TO PRISON
The detained suspect was referred to the judicial authorities after processing at the police station. The suspect, who was brought before the court, was arrested and sent to prison.
